At the Oasisa Free Online Love Story by Sky Taylor - Page 1Rance squinted the dark eyes at Jezzy, his ninety-two year old neighbor. There was not a doubt in his mind that she hadn’t swiped his milk cow. And this wasn’t her first Ferret Rodeo. In fact, her hobby ranch contained several of his ‘former’ stock including a Rhode Island red rooster, a minimum of two dozen hens, three lambs, five goats, and his female bulldog Bea - which Jezzy had renamed Concubine. Unfortunately, as he had questioned her, Jezzy was as calm as a cucumber - the only tell-tale of her frustration being the frayed snow-white hair which was standing on end. The shaky voice informed him, “You’ll have to confer with Daffney on the cow.” “You named the cow Daffney?” Rance asked for clarification because Jezzy could be a five-thousand piece puzzle at times. “No, but I think it’s a nice name for a pony,” Jezzy decided, the gray eyes twinkling as she consider the prospects - Rance instantly realizing that one of his horses was next on her ‘must have’ list. Thinking it best to stick to the conversation of cows he averted her pony comment with, “Jezzy, about my missing cow-” “Are you deaf, dear?” Jezzy tossed back, reclaiming her rocking chair along with her knitting basket upon which she focused her full concentration. “I’ve told you that you’ll have to confer with Daffney.” Rance capped the straw hat back onto his dark cap of hair and delivered a defeated sigh. What now? It just didn’t feel right - collecting the cow and taking her back to the ranch. And he wasn’t about to get the law involved.
